Ed Sheeran is back with a new album called Play, set to release in September 2025. It marks the start of a fresh series of music projects.

🎵 A New Direction: From Math to Media Symbols

Sheeran's earlier albums—Plus (+), Multiply (×), Divide (÷), Subtract (−), and Equals (=)—reflected a consistent thematic approach. With Play, he initiates a new series inspired by media control symbols, planning future albums titled Pause, Fast Forward, Rewind, and Stop. This concept was influenced by filmmaker Quentin Tarantino's idea of creating a set number of works before concluding a chapter in his career.

🌍 Global Inspirations and Collaborations

Play showcases Sheeran's exploration of diverse musical cultures. He collaborated with international artists, including Iranian singer Googoosh on the Persian version of "Azizam" and Indian musician Arijit Singh, whom he visited in a remote village in India for a unique recording experience .

🎶 Singles Leading Up to the Album

  • "Azizam": Released on April 4, 2025, this track blends Middle Eastern musical elements, reflecting Sheeran's collaboration with producer Ilya Salmanzadeh .

  • "Old Phone": Released on May 1, 2025, this nostalgic song was inspired by messages found on Sheeran's old mobile phone, evoking memories and past experiences .

🎤 Upcoming Performances

Sheeran is scheduled to perform at Portman Road Stadium in Ipswich on July 11, 12, and 13, 2025. These concerts will feature a mix of his classic hits and new tracks from Play .
